How many people live in Custer County, South Dakota?
Custer County, South Dakota has about 6,179 residents according to the 1990 Census.
What is the median household income in Custer County, South Dakota?
The typical household in Custer County, South Dakota earns about $22,662 a year. Half of households make more than that, and half make less.
Is Custer County, South Dakota expensive?
In Custer County, South Dakota, the median home is worth about $46,500, and the typical rent is about $315 a month.
How educated are people in Custer County, South Dakota?
About 17.5% of adults age 25 and over in Custer County, South Dakota hold a bachelor's degree or higher.
What is the poverty rate in Custer County, South Dakota?
About 12.4% of people in Custer County, South Dakota live below the federal poverty line.
